Meadow Foxtail and Blue Eyed Daisy Plant Physical Information

Meadow Foxtail and Blue Eyed Daisy Plant physical information is very important for comparison. Meadow Foxtail height is 61.00 cm and width 40.60 cm whereas Blue Eyed Daisy Plant height is 36.00 cm and width 51.00 cm. The color specification of Meadow Foxtail and Blue Eyed Daisy Plant are as follows:

  • Meadow Foxtail flower color: White

  • Meadow Foxtail leaf color: Green

  • Blue Eyed Daisy Plant flower color: White, Purple and Blue Violet

  • Blue Eyed Daisy Plant leaf color: Green

Care of Meadow Foxtail and Blue Eyed Daisy Plant

Care of Meadow Foxtail and Blue Eyed Daisy Plant include pruning, fertilizers, watering etc. Meadow Foxtail pruning is done Prune to control growth and Blue Eyed Daisy Plant pruning is done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ches and Remove dead leaves. In summer Meadow Foxtail need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Moderate. Whereas, in summer Blue Eyed Daisy Plant needs Lots of watering and in winter, it needs Average Water.
